Output 839c70f174d76fd590e319a7f439aacd1347ef66bf759896e306abcec63e4d8e:7

value
718430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82e95db2b47f31dc3a9e8ed1f0e37fe7994ec796 OP_EQUAL
address
3DdDL344ZnY9XtrAbEFmxBENYtyVouqKms
transaction
839c70f174d76fd590e319a7f439aacd1347ef66bf759896e306abcec63e4d8e
spent
true